The 10 Metre was a sailing event on the Sailing at the 1912 Summer Olympics program in Nynäshamn. Two races were scheduled plus eventual sail-off's. 28 sailors, on 4 boats, from 3 nation entered.

Final results

The 1912 Olympic scoring system was used. All competitors were male.

  • There was one sail-off between Nina and Gallia II for place 2 & 3.
